Here’s where thousands of Hummingbirds are migrating to – and where you can catch it.

Fall migration is currently underway across the United States, marking the commencement of one of the most remarkable endurance feats in the avian world. As seasonal temperatures begin to shift and day lengths shorten, the Ruby-throated Hummingbird (Archilochus colubris) has begun its arduous transit from the breeding grounds of the eastern United States and southern Canada toward its wintering territories in Mexico and Central America. This mass movement of millions of individuals is not merely a seasonal occurrence; it is a biological imperative that highlights the extraordinary physiological capabilities of one of the world’s smallest warm-blooded creatures.

The Mechanics of an Epic Journey

Despite weighing roughly the same as a single U.S. penny—averaging between 2.5 and 4 grams—these diminutive birds possess the capacity to traverse immense distances. During their annual migration, many Ruby-throated Hummingbirds will fly hundreds, and in some cases well over 1,000 miles, to reach their destination. The timing of this migration is dictated by complex environmental cues, including photoperiodism—the change in the duration of daylight—which triggers a physiological state known as hyperphagia.

Hyperphagia is a period of intense feeding during which hummingbirds increase their body mass by as much as 25 to 40 percent. They consume vast quantities of nectar, which provides the necessary carbohydrates for immediate energy, while also preying on small insects and spiders to acquire the proteins and fats required for sustained muscle maintenance during their long-distance flight.

The Gulf Coast Gauntlet: A 500-Mile Crossing

One of the most perilous segments of the migration occurs when the birds reach the Gulf Coast. Ornithologists have observed two primary strategies utilized by the species to navigate this formidable barrier. A portion of the population opts for a coastal route, hugging the shoreline through Louisiana and Texas, which allows for frequent stops to forage. However, a significant number of birds undertake a non-stop, trans-Gulf flight.

For those choosing the direct path, the journey represents a grueling 500-mile flight across the open waters of the Gulf of Mexico. This trajectory requires the birds to remain in constant flight for approximately 18 to 22 hours without the possibility of refueling or rest. The success of this crossing is entirely dependent on the energy reserves acquired in the weeks prior to departure. If weather conditions, such as sudden cold fronts or heavy rainfall, coincide with this crossing, the mortality rate can increase, underscoring the vital importance of high-quality stopover habitats along the northern Gulf Coast.

Chronology and Seasonal Peaks

The migration of the Ruby-throated Hummingbird is a protracted event, typically occurring in stages throughout the late summer and early autumn. Adult males are generally the first to depart their breeding territories, often beginning their movement southward as early as mid-to-late August. Females and juveniles follow, with the bulk of the population moving through the southern United States throughout September and into early October.

For birdwatchers and researchers, this window of time provides a unique opportunity to observe high concentrations of these birds. The Gulf Coast serves as a critical "bottleneck" area, where the funneling of birds creates a natural staging ground. Organizations such as the Gulf Coast Bird Observatory (GCBO) in Texas track these movements with precision, noting that mid-September acts as a peak period for observation.

To mark this occurrence, institutions like the GCBO organize educational events, such as the annual Xtreme Hummingbird Xtravaganza, held this year on September 12 and 19. These events serve to educate the public on the necessity of habitat conservation, specifically regarding the native flowering plants that provide essential nectar sources for migrating hummingbirds.

Ecological Significance and Habitat Requirements

The survival of the Ruby-throated Hummingbird is inextricably linked to the availability of stopover habitats. As these birds travel southward, they require a "chain" of foraging opportunities. If a link in this chain is broken—due to habitat loss, urban development, or the degradation of native plant populations—the ability of the population to complete its migration is compromised.

Experts in avian ecology emphasize that the loss of native flora is a primary threat to migratory birds. Non-native, ornamental plants often fail to provide the caloric density required by hummingbirds. Consequently, conservationists strongly advocate for the planting of nectar-rich native species such as Salvia, Bee Balm, and Trumpet Vine. These plants not only provide fuel for the birds but also support the local insect populations that serve as a necessary protein source.

Public Observation and Citizen Science

For residents of the eastern and southern United States, the month of September offers an excellent opportunity to engage in amateur ornithology. Hummingbirds are frequently seen hovering around backyard feeders and late-blooming garden flowers. However, it is important to note that these sightings are often fleeting. Unlike local breeding birds that stay in one territory for months, migrants are transient, often remaining in a specific location for only a few days before continuing their southward trek.

To contribute to scientific understanding, many birders participate in citizen science programs such as eBird or the Hummingbird Monitoring Network. By logging sightings, dates, and behavior, the public helps researchers build a more accurate map of migratory timing and population health. This data is essential for assessing the impact of climate change on migration patterns, as warming trends in the northern hemisphere can cause a mismatch between the birds’ arrival in breeding zones and the peak bloom of nectar sources.

Broader Implications of Migration Shifts

The migration of the Ruby-throated Hummingbird is a bellwether for the health of the ecosystems through which it travels. Because these birds are highly sensitive to their environment, changes in their migration timing or success rates can signal broader ecological shifts. For instance, increased frequency of extreme weather events—often linked to climate change—can force birds to deviate from their traditional flight paths or deplete their energy reserves prematurely.

Furthermore, the expansion of artificial light at night (ALAN) in urban corridors poses a significant risk to migratory species, potentially disorienting them during their nocturnal flights. Addressing these challenges requires a multi-faceted approach, including the preservation of large-scale migratory corridors and the implementation of "lights-out" policies in major metropolitan areas during the migration peak.
